Job summary:

The Certified Occupational Therapist Assistant (COTA) works under the supervision of a licensed Occupational Therapist (OT) to provide high-quality occupational therapy services to residents.

The COTA assists in implementing treatment plans, monitoring patient progress, and helping residents improve their independence and quality of life.

Responsibilities


* Implement and execute individualized treatment plans for residents under the supervision of a licensed Occupational Therapist.


* Provide skilled therapeutic interventions, including training in activities of daily living (ADLs), functional skills, and the use of adaptive equipment.


* Help residents reach their maximum performance level and function within their capabilities.


* Monitor and accurately document residents' progress and report any changes to the supervising Occupational Therapist.


* Collaborate with an interdisciplinary team to deliver comprehensive patient care.


* Instruct residents, their families, and nursing staff on maintenance programs for discharge.


* Maintain a clean, organized, and safe therapy environment, including the large, on-site gym.


* Perform all duties in compliance with regulatory standards and facility policies.

Qualifications


* Associate degree from an accredited Occupational Therapy Assistant program.


* Valid Occupational Therapist Assistant (COTA) license or certification.
